WebThe special property of an eigenvector is that it transforms into a scaled version of itself under the operation of A. Note that the eigenvector equation is non-linear in both the eigenvalue ( ) and the eigenvector (x ). The usual procedure is to first identify the eigenvalues and then find the associated eigenvectors. The entropy density sL @fL @T ;h, WebEigenvalues are roots of the characteristic equation: The eigenvalues of a matrix are the solutions to the characteristic equation, det(A - λI) = 0. 3. Eigenvalues are invariant under similarity transformations: If two matrices A and B are similar, meaning there exists an invertible matrix P such that B = P⁻¹AP, then A and B have the same ...
